Output 3034ec4176bf42d7897bcf0fab15a5c02c7424b1e26f4db0af5c475ce482056a:0

value
25490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68185928c442174219026d2854b21a3bf1b9ecf8 OP_EQUAL
address
3BBRNEzrRcNoS2RVPMA87ykeF9pSMmfDXH
transaction
3034ec4176bf42d7897bcf0fab15a5c02c7424b1e26f4db0af5c475ce482056a
spent
true